How seismic is this area?
Medium-low seismicity: strong quakes are rare, but not impossible.
Official Civil Protection classification (upd. 2025), used for building codes.
Hazard describes the long-term expected shaking: it is not a forecast. Technical value: ag = 0.076 g (10% probability of exceedance in 50 years, rigid soil).
The “area” is Canda plus nearby towns.
The seismic history of Canda
The earthquakes that were actually felt in Canda over the centuries, with the intensity observed on site (Mercalli MCS scale).
- 2000III18 June 2000
Light: felt by few people, like a passing truck.
Pianura emiliana earthquake (M4.4), epicentre 68 km away
- 1998NF26 March 1998
Imperceptible: only instruments record it.
Appennino umbro-marchigiano earthquake (M5.3), epicentre 235 km away
- 1987IV2 May 1987
Moderate: felt by many indoors; glasses and dishes rattle.
Reggiano earthquake (M4.7), epicentre 70 km away
- 1986IV-V6 December 1986
Rather strong: felt by almost everyone; hanging objects swing.
Ferrarese earthquake (M4.4), epicentre 13 km away
- 1983IV9 November 1983
Moderate: felt by many indoors; glasses and dishes rattle.
Parmense earthquake (M5.0), epicentre 104 km away
- 1971III-IV15 July 1971
Moderate: felt by many indoors; glasses and dishes rattle.
Parmense earthquake (M5.5), epicentre 96 km away
Source: Italian Macroseismic Database DBMI15 (INGV, CC BY 4.0).

The closest seismic structure
The town lies about 11 km from Poggio Rusco-Migliarino, one of the seismic structures mapped by INGV geologists.
Faults are mapped to build better and understand the territory: knowing them says nothing about when an earthquake will occur, which remains unpredictable. Source: DISS 3.3 (INGV, CC BY 4.0).

Is Canda a seismic area?
Canda is classified in seismic zone 3 by the Civil Protection. Medium-low seismicity: strong quakes are rare, but not impossible.
What was the strongest earthquake near Canda?
In the last ~12 years of INGV data, the strongest within 30 km of Canda was magnitude 4.2, in 2023.
